In a major political development on Tuesday evening, the Leader of the Opposition in the Lok Sabha, Rahul Gandhi, and Congress General Secretary Priyanka Gandhi Vadra were released from police custody. Their release followed a period of detention that began after they led a massive protest outside the Prime Minister's residence, while the demonstration was organized to voice concerns over the recent paper leak incidents and to demand the immediate resignations of the Union Education Minister and the Prime Minister.
Details of the Detention and Locations
The police action took place earlier in the day when a large number of opposition leaders and workers gathered near the Prime Minister's residence. Following the intervention by the Delhi Police, the leaders were moved to different locations to disperse the crowd. Rahul Gandhi was taken to the Chhatrasal Stadium, which served as a temporary detention site. On the other hand, Priyanka Gandhi Vadra was transported to the Mandir Marg Police Station in New Delhi. Other Members of Parliament and protesters were shifted to the Kingsway Camp area as part of the police measures to maintain order.
Opposition Unity and High Profile Participation
The protest saw a significant turnout of prominent opposition figures, while along with Rahul Gandhi and Priyanka Gandhi Vadra, the demonstration included Congress President and Leader of the Opposition in the Rajya Sabha, Mallikarjun Kharge. Samajwadi Party chief Akhilesh Yadav also joined the protest, highlighting the unity among various opposition parties on the issue of student welfare and educational integrity. The Delhi Police eventually removed the protesters from the site and distributed them across various detention points in the city.
Sonia Gandhi Visits Mandir Marg Police Station
Upon receiving news of Priyanka Gandhi Vadra's detention, former Congress President Sonia Gandhi arrived at the Mandir Marg Police Station. She met with Priyanka Gandhi to offer support. After the meeting, Sonia Gandhi left the premises without addressing the media. The visit underscored the gravity of the situation and the party's internal solidarity during the police action.
